**Q: Why does the Pinchwick image cache grow unbounded?**

A: Known leak: thumbnails fetched through the Dovelane renderer keep strong references in the eviction map, so LRU never frees them. A patch lands next sprint; until then, the cache is flushed nightly by a cron task. If the flush job stalls and you need to trigger it manually, the admin tool will ask for the recovery passphrase, which appears just below.

strongbox words: norwyn-wenael-aldvan-aldiel-wendor-holael

Handover for Liftframe, our elevator-dispatch simulator. Plugin authors: dispatch strategies register through the `StrategyHook` interface, and the simulator validates car-capacity assumptions at load time. Timing models changed in v2, so re-test any plugin written against v1. The simulator initializes every run from the configuration values that follow.

config for kafof-bawef:
holath:
  log_level: debug
  metrics_host: metrics.holath.qorvelsys.internal
  pin: 2191
  pool_size: 32

## Currency Rounding: Limits & Quotas

Quick heads-up for reviewers poking at Tillgate's conversion layer: we round at display time, never in the ledger. All amounts are stored as scaled integers, and conversions through the Fenwick rate service keep six decimal places internally. The fun part is drift — repeated round-trips between minor currencies can shed fractions of a cent, so we cap conversion hops and reconcile nightly. The guardrails live in the constants below.

tuning table, kajog-bawip:
TIERS = {
    "kelius": 256,
    "lammir": 543,
}

Step 6: Spreadsheet export memory controls

Before approving the Ferrowick deploy, verify the export worker caps memory during large spreadsheet generation. Set XLS_EXPORT_MAX_ROWS=50000 and XLS_STREAMING=true in the worker .env; streaming mode prevents the full workbook from being buffered in memory. The export signer must also authenticate chunks against the storage tier, so directly beneath those two settings, add this line:

secret setting of yajog-taguf: ARCHIVE_KEY3=051